Painting Description
Ernst Walbourn, a British artist born in 1872, is renowned for his idyllic depictions of rural life and pastoral scenes, often featuring women and children in harmonious natural settings. One of his notable works, "Feeding Hens," exemplifies his characteristic style and thematic focus. This painting captures a serene moment in the countryside, where a young woman is engaged in the simple, yet timeless, task of feeding hens. The composition is imbued with a sense of tranquility and nostalgia, reflecting Walbourn's ability to romanticize everyday rural activities.
"Feeding Hens" showcases Walbourn's meticulous attention to detail and his adept use of color and light to create a warm, inviting atmosphere. The artist's brushwork is delicate and precise, bringing to life the textures of the woman's clothing, the feathers of the hens, and the surrounding natural environment. The soft, diffused light bathes the scene, enhancing the overall sense of peace and contentment.
Walbourn's work is often associated with the late Victorian and Edwardian periods, during which there was a growing appreciation for the simplicity and purity of rural life, possibly as a counterpoint to the rapid industrialization and urbanization of the time. "Feeding Hens" reflects this sentiment, offering viewers a glimpse into a world where life is governed by the rhythms of nature and the seasons.
The painting not only highlights Walbourn's technical skill but also his ability to evoke emotion and tell a story through his art. "Feeding Hens" remains a testament to his enduring legacy as an artist who captured the beauty and simplicity of rural life with grace and sensitivity.
